What is $257,615 After Taxes in California?

A $257,615 salary in California takes home $164,924 after federal income tax, state income tax, and FICA — a 36.0% effective tax rate.

California Tax Overview

California's 13.3% top marginal rate is the highest in the nation, applying to income over $1 million. Even moderate earners face meaningful state tax burden: a single filer at $75,000 hits the 9.3% bracket. The state also levies SDI (State Disability Insurance) at 0.9% on all wages with no cap. SDI rate: 0.9% on all wages (no wage limit in 2025).
